[Predictive markers of immunotherapy in cervical cancer].

E M OlyushinaL E ZavalishinaYulia Yu AndreevaO A KuznetsovaL V MoskvinaG A Frank
Published in: Arkhiv patologii (2023)
A positive PD-L1 status is determined in a significant number of cases of CC, regardless of most of the studied clinical and morphological characteristics; there is a statistically significant relationship between PD-L1 expression and the degree of tumor differentiation and TILs. It has been shown that CC with the MSI/dMMR phenomenon is characterized by a positive PD-L1 status. The authors consider it necessary to study the expression of PD-L1 in patients with cervical carcinomas in order to determine the possibility of prescribing personalized therapy with immune checkpoint inhibitors.
